When we talk about affordability in assisted living, it's crucial to look beyond just the monthly rent. True affordability means understanding what is included in that cost—such as meals, housekeeping, medication management, and personal care assistance. In the Cascilla area, you may find that some smaller, residential-style care homes or family care homes offer a more personalized environment at a potentially lower cost than larger commercial facilities. These homes, often located in quiet neighborhoods, provide a homelike atmosphere with a high staff-to-resident ratio. It's worth driving through local communities and asking for recommendations at places like the Tallahatchie County Senior Center or your local church; word-of-mouth remains a powerful tool in our close-knit area.
Another key to affordability is exploring all available financial assistance programs. Mississippi offers several resources that can help bridge the gap. The Mississippi Division of Medicaid’s Home and Community-Based Services (HCBS) waivers can provide funding for assisted living services for those who qualify. Additionally, veterans and their spouses should absolutely investigate Aid and Attendance benefits through the VA, which can provide a substantial monthly pension to help cover care costs. Speaking with a local Area Agency on Aging advisor can provide free, personalized guidance on navigating these complex programs. They can help you understand eligibility and application processes specific to our region.
When visiting potential communities, whether in Cascilla or in nearby towns like Charleston or Batesville, ask very specific questions. Inquire about any potential fee increases and how they are communicated. Ask if there are different pricing tiers based on the level of care needed, as this can allow for a more tailored and cost-effective plan.
